Amid the flurry of parties, after-parties and the countless celebrity—and, increasingly, reality TV personality—photo ops, the casual observer might be confused as to why the international fashion community descends on New York for no less than a week every February and September. The Big Apple is the first leg of a four-city relay that showcases the bulk of international collections—in other words, a peek at how the world will dress six months from now.  read more »

Kaikai Kiki Breeds the Next Murakamis

Kaikai Kiki opening, photo by Kei Katagami
Already massively successful, Japanese pop artist Takashi Murakami has collaborated with Louis Vuitton and is the subject of the blockbuster traveling retrospective, © MURAKAMI, currently at MOCA in LA and slated to travel around the world. But at the moment Murakami isn't focused on his own career, he's working to foster a similar commercial success for his protégés at Kaikai Kiki, his art production company/collective.
